CWE-834
DiscouragedExcessive Iteration
Abstraction: Class · Status: Incomplete
The product performs an iteration or loop without sufficiently limiting the number of times that the loop is executed.

GHSA-4PXV-J86V-MHCW
Vulnerability from github – Published: 2026-04-16 21:30 – Updated: 2026-05-05 15:44Impact
An attacker who uses this vulnerability can craft a PDF which leads to long runtimes. This requires loading a PDF with a large trailer /Size value in incremental mode.
Patches
This has been fixed in pypdf==6.10.2.
Workarounds
If you cannot upgrade yet, consider applying the changes from PR #3735.
